This is a first cut of the generalization of <available> and
<uptodate> that is on the list for Ant2. This task supports a single
condition and sets a property if it holds true - conditions can be
containers for other conditions in turn, giving it the opportunity to
support boolean logic.
Built in conditions as of now:
* <available> and <uptodate> (slightly modified the tasks to allow them to
be used as conditions)
* containers <and>, <or> and <not>
* New conditions <equals> (compares to Strings) and <os> which should
give easier access to os.name.
More extensive documentation to follow. Take a look at Ant's build
file, it uses the task to detect whether javamail is available now.
I had to perform some ugly tricks to make sure that project gets
passed to every object that will need it - this will be very different
in the future I hope.
